< prev index next >
make/CreateSecurityJars.gmk
Print this page
rev 12525 : 8157561: Ship the unlimited policy files in JDK Updates
Reviewed-by: wetmore, erikj
*** 1,7 ****
#
! # Copyright (c) 2013, Oracle and/or its affiliates. All rights reserved.
# DO NOT ALTER OR REMOVE COPYRIGHT NOTICES OR THIS FILE HEADER.
#
# This code is free software; you can redistribute it and/or modify it
# under the terms of the GNU General Public License version 2 only, as
# published by the Free Software Foundation. Oracle designates this
--- 1,7 ----
#
! # Copyright (c) 2013, 2016, Oracle and/or its affiliates. All rights reserved.
# DO NOT ALTER OR REMOVE COPYRIGHT NOTICES OR THIS FILE HEADER.
#
# This code is free software; you can redistribute it and/or modify it
# under the terms of the GNU General Public License version 2 only, as
# published by the Free Software Foundation. Oracle designates this
*** 176,186 ****
TARGETS += $(JCE_JAR_DST)
##########################################################################################
! US_EXPORT_POLICY_JAR_DST := $(JDK_OUTPUTDIR)/lib/security/US_export_policy.jar
ifneq ($(BUILD_CRYPTO), no)
US_EXPORT_POLICY_JAR_LIMITED_UNSIGNED := \
$(JDK_OUTPUTDIR)/jce/unsigned/policy/limited/US_export_policy.jar
--- 176,189 ----
TARGETS += $(JCE_JAR_DST)
##########################################################################################
! US_EXPORT_POLICY_JAR_UNLIMITED_DST := \
! $(JDK_OUTPUTDIR)/lib/security/policy/unlimited/US_export_policy.jar
! US_EXPORT_POLICY_JAR_LIMITED_DST := \
! $(JDK_OUTPUTDIR)/lib/security/policy/limited/US_export_policy.jar
ifneq ($(BUILD_CRYPTO), no)
US_EXPORT_POLICY_JAR_LIMITED_UNSIGNED := \
$(JDK_OUTPUTDIR)/jce/unsigned/policy/limited/US_export_policy.jar
*** 218,248 ****
TARGETS += $(US_EXPORT_POLICY_JAR_LIMITED_UNSIGNED) \
$(US_EXPORT_POLICY_JAR_UNLIMITED_UNSIGNED)
endif
ifndef OPENJDK
! ifeq ($(UNLIMITED_CRYPTO), true)
! $(error No prebuilt unlimited crypto jars available)
! endif
! $(US_EXPORT_POLICY_JAR_DST): $(JDK_TOPDIR)/make/closed/tools/crypto/jce/US_export_policy.jar
$(ECHO) $(LOG_INFO) Copying prebuilt $(@F)
$(install-file)
else
! ifeq ($(UNLIMITED_CRYPTO), true)
! $(US_EXPORT_POLICY_JAR_DST): $(US_EXPORT_POLICY_JAR_UNLIMITED_UNSIGNED)
$(install-file)
! else
! $(US_EXPORT_POLICY_JAR_DST): $(US_EXPORT_POLICY_JAR_LIMITED_UNSIGNED)
$(install-file)
endif
- endif
! TARGETS += $(US_EXPORT_POLICY_JAR_DST)
##########################################################################################
! LOCAL_POLICY_JAR_DST := $(JDK_OUTPUTDIR)/lib/security/local_policy.jar
ifneq ($(BUILD_CRYPTO), no)
LOCAL_POLICY_JAR_LIMITED_UNSIGNED := \
$(JDK_OUTPUTDIR)/jce/unsigned/policy/limited/local_policy.jar
--- 221,253 ----
TARGETS += $(US_EXPORT_POLICY_JAR_LIMITED_UNSIGNED) \
$(US_EXPORT_POLICY_JAR_UNLIMITED_UNSIGNED)
endif
ifndef OPENJDK
! $(US_EXPORT_POLICY_JAR_UNLIMITED_DST): \
! $(JDK_TOPDIR)/make/closed/tools/crypto/jce/unlimited/US_export_policy.jar
! $(ECHO) $(LOG_INFO) Copying prebuilt $(@F)
! $(install-file)
! $(US_EXPORT_POLICY_JAR_LIMITED_DST): \
! $(JDK_TOPDIR)/make/closed/tools/crypto/jce/limited/US_export_policy.jar
$(ECHO) $(LOG_INFO) Copying prebuilt $(@F)
$(install-file)
else
! $(US_EXPORT_POLICY_JAR_UNLIMITED_DST): $(US_EXPORT_POLICY_JAR_UNLIMITED_UNSIGNED)
$(install-file)
! $(US_EXPORT_POLICY_JAR_LIMITED_DST): $(US_EXPORT_POLICY_JAR_LIMITED_UNSIGNED)
$(install-file)
endif
! TARGETS += $(US_EXPORT_POLICY_JAR_UNLIMITED_DST) $(US_EXPORT_POLICY_JAR_LIMITED_DST)
##########################################################################################
! LOCAL_POLICY_JAR_LIMITED_DST := \
! $(JDK_OUTPUTDIR)/lib/security/policy/limited/local_policy.jar
! LOCAL_POLICY_JAR_UNLIMITED_DST := \
! $(JDK_OUTPUTDIR)/lib/security/policy/unlimited/local_policy.jar
ifneq ($(BUILD_CRYPTO), no)
LOCAL_POLICY_JAR_LIMITED_UNSIGNED := \
$(JDK_OUTPUTDIR)/jce/unsigned/policy/limited/local_policy.jar
*** 291,314 ****
TARGETS += $(JDK_OUTPUTDIR)/jce/unsigned/policy/unlimited/README.txt
endif
endif
ifndef OPENJDK
! $(LOCAL_POLICY_JAR_DST): $(JDK_TOPDIR)/make/closed/tools/crypto/jce/local_policy.jar
$(ECHO) $(LOG_INFO) Copying prebuilt $(@F)
$(install-file)
else
! ifeq ($(UNLIMITED_CRYPTO), true)
! $(LOCAL_POLICY_JAR_DST): $(LOCAL_POLICY_JAR_UNLIMITED_UNSIGNED)
$(install-file)
! else
! $(LOCAL_POLICY_JAR_DST): $(LOCAL_POLICY_JAR_LIMITED_UNSIGNED)
$(install-file)
endif
- endif
! TARGETS += $(LOCAL_POLICY_JAR_DST)
##########################################################################################
ifeq ($(OPENJDK_TARGET_OS), windows)
--- 296,319 ----
TARGETS += $(JDK_OUTPUTDIR)/jce/unsigned/policy/unlimited/README.txt
endif
endif
ifndef OPENJDK
! $(LOCAL_POLICY_JAR_UNLIMITED_DST): $(JDK_TOPDIR)/make/closed/tools/crypto/jce/unlimited/local_policy.jar
! $(ECHO) $(LOG_INFO) Copying prebuilt $(@F)
! $(install-file)
! $(LOCAL_POLICY_JAR_LIMITED_DST): $(JDK_TOPDIR)/make/closed/tools/crypto/jce/limited/local_policy.jar
$(ECHO) $(LOG_INFO) Copying prebuilt $(@F)
$(install-file)
else
! $(LOCAL_POLICY_JAR_UNLIMITED_DST): $(LOCAL_POLICY_JAR_UNLIMITED_UNSIGNED)
$(install-file)
! $(LOCAL_POLICY_JAR_LIMITED_DST): $(LOCAL_POLICY_JAR_LIMITED_UNSIGNED)
$(install-file)
endif
! TARGETS += $(LOCAL_POLICY_JAR_UNLIMITED_DST) $(LOCAL_POLICY_JAR_LIMITED_DST)
##########################################################################################
ifeq ($(OPENJDK_TARGET_OS), windows)
< prev index next >